Output 7e07a8df803c15cded47ff76f373b99df0a4b14266e2b4f26cc597e528316c4c:1

value
8566116
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86ae643b6aa20d3646cfd0f1a266ae674279838d OP_EQUAL
address
3Dy9PBgqKY42ZVx8SBpDFQn7oJJ8CUksCf
transaction
7e07a8df803c15cded47ff76f373b99df0a4b14266e2b4f26cc597e528316c4c
confirmations
260526
spent
true